CVE-2026-82697
sambitraj Student-Management-System session_start cookie httponly flag
Description

A security vulnerability has been detected in sambitraj Student-Management-System up to 56ba287f2e9031523ccb4244cb6e3fe530e4e5d5. The impacted element is the function session_start. Such manipulation leads to cookie without 'httponly' flag. The attack may be launched remotely. A high complexity level is associated with this attack. The exploitability is regarded as difficult. The exploit has been disclosed publicly and may be used. This product operates on a rolling release basis, ensuring continuous delivery. Consequently, there are no version details for either affected or updated releases. The project was informed of the problem early through an issue report but has not responded yet.

Solution
Update the application to set the HttpOnly flag on session cookies.
  • Ensure session cookies have the HttpOnly flag set.
  • Review session management configurations.
  • Implement secure cookie handling practices.
